Position Overview
| Position Summary |
Are you a financial professional who is passionate about higher education and student success? Join the Ramily!
Winston-Salem State University (
WSSU) is seeking a Finance Manager - Restricted Funds.
The Finance Manager - Restricted Funds is responsible for the oversight, financial management, and compliance of Winston-Salem State University's restricted accounts, including endowments, scholarships, sponsored gifts, and donor-restricted funds (including
WSSU Foundation funds). This role ensures accurate financial reporting, regulatory and donor compliance, and effective stewardship of restricted resources in alignment with University and
UNC System policies, as well as applicable state, federal, and donor guidelines. The Finance Manager will collaborate with Advancement, the
WSSU Foundation, academic units, and external auditors to ensure funds are managed with transparency, integrity, and efficiency.
Responsibilities of the Finance Manager - Restricted Funds:
Financial Oversight & Reporting
- Manage accounting, reconciliation, and financial reporting for all restricted and endowed funds.
-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ual reports on restricted fund activity for senior leadership, Advancement, and the WSSU Foundation.
- Ensure timely posting and reconciliation of revenues, expenditures, transfers, and investment earnings.
- Partner with the Controller's Office to prepare required financial statements, schedules, and disclosures related to restricted assets.
- May utilize financial software to account for Foundation financial activity and complete monthly bank and investment statement reconciliations.
Compliance & Stewardship
- Ensure all restricted funds are administered in accordance with donor intent, university policy, UNC System guidelines, and applicable legal/regulatory requirements.
- Oversee endowment spending calculations, payout schedules, and monitoring of fund balances.
- Serve as primary point of contact for internal and external audits of restricted accounts.
- Monitor compliance with grant and gift agreements, ensuring expenditures meet donor restrictions.
Collaboration & Process Improvement
- Partner with University Advancement and the WSSU Foundation to strengthen stewardship reporting to donors.
- Provide financial guidance to academic and administrative units on the appropriate use of restricted funds.
- Support budgeting and forecasting processes related to scholarships, endowment payouts, and gift-funded initiatives.
- Develop and improve financial controls, processes, and reporting tools to enhance efficiency and accountability.
Leadership & Communication
- May supervise staff assigned to restricted fund management.
- Present fund performance and compliance updates to University leadership and Board/Foundation committees as needed.
- Educate stakeholders across campus on restricted fund management best practices and compliance requirements.

| Department Required Skills |
-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, Business Administration, or related field.
- At least 4 years of progressive financial management experience, with preference for experience in higher education, foundations, or nonprofit fund accounting.
- Strong knowledge of
GAAP, fund accounting, and endowment/gift fund management practices.
- Demonstrated experience preparing financial reports, audits, and reconciliations.
- High attention to detail, analytical skills, and ability to manage multiple priorities.
|
| Preferred Years Experience, Skills, Training, Education |
- Master's degree in Accounting, Finance, Business Administration, or related field.
- Experience with
UNC System financial policies, state fund accounting, or similar higher education frameworks.
- Familiarity with donor stewardship practices and Advancement/Foundation partnerships. |
